22/7/2020 08:43 | Gold is now above $1,850....and Tamesis Partners have released their new research on CAPD. They've retained their 100p price target (with $135.3m revenues for the year). Their forecasts are rounded, so I calculate they go for 7.22c EPS this year and 8.25c EPS next year, i.e at $1.25 that's 5.8p rising to 6.6p EPS. They summarise as "extremely undervalued" - the EV/EBITDA in particular looks ridiculously low, highlighting the excellent cash flows: "So overall a lot of things going right for the company that should continue to deliver reward for shareholders,not least the gold price environment. Management continue to lay down a strong track record in revenue and EBITDA growth – see table below. As such the shares continue to look extremely undervalued; trading on a 2020E EV/EBITDA and P/E of 2.8x and 10.8x respectively, falling to 2.6x and 9.4x respectively for 2021." | rivaldo | |
